Abstract
Determining the level of insect infestation which causes economic damage (yield loss or significant crop maturity delays), is no simple task. The more we learn about plant responses to damage and those factors which effect plant and insect growth or survival, the more it is apparent that insect thresholds need to be dynamic rather than set on any one predetermined value
